So if you still want that satisfaction of pulling out a warm loaf of bread from the oven, without the time commitment, then this Guinness bread is the way to go.
Ingredients
- 400g whole wheat flour
- 100g rolled oats, plus extra for the top
- 2 tsp baking soda
- 1 tsp salt
- 70g walnuts, roughly chopped
- 1 tbsp molasses
- 1 tbsp golden syrup
- 330ml Guinness
- 170ml buttermilk
Method
- Preheat the oven to 350°F.
- In a large mixing bowl, mix the whole wheat flour, rolled oats, baking soda, salt, and walnuts.
- In a separate large bowl, whisk together the buttermilk, Guinness, molasses, and golden syrup.
- Create a well in the bowl with the dry ingredients, then add the wet ingredients. Stir together until well-combined.
- Lightly butter a loaf tin and line with parchment paper. Transfer the dough into the tin. Sprinkle a handful of rolled oats onto the top. Bake in the oven 45 minutes.
- Once done, transfer the bread onto a wire rack and let cool before slicing in.
Christine & Marissa’s Tip
“We love to serve this with some cream cheese, smoked salmon, and thinly sliced cucumber. It also works great alongside soup!”
